数据库原理及应用教程怎么学?📚小白也能快速入门吗?-数据库-EDUC教育网
教育
教育网
学习留学移民英语学校教育
联系我们SITEMAP
教育学习数据库

数据库原理及应用教程怎么学?📚小白也能快速入门吗?

2026-01-07 19:43:45 发布

数据库原理及应用教程怎么学?📚小白也能快速入门吗?,详解数据库原理及应用教程的学习路径,从基础概念到实际操作,结合真实案例分享高效学习方法,帮助初学者轻松掌握数据库核心技能。

一、什么是数据库?为什么它这么重要?✨

想问问大家,有没有想过:为什么手机通讯录能记住几百个联系人?为什么银行系统可以瞬间查询你的余额?答案就在数据库里!数据库就像一个“超级记忆体”,用来存储和管理海量信息。
数据库的核心是“结构化数据”。举个例子:假设你有一个超市的库存表,里面包含商品名称、价格、数量等信息。如果用传统的Excel表格来管理,当数据量增大时,效率会变得极低。而数据库则可以通过优化查询语言(如SQL)快速检索出你需要的信息。
💡 小贴士:数据库不仅在企业中广泛应用,还与我们的日常生活息息相关。比如你在社交媒体上点赞、评论,这些数据都会被存储到数据库中哦!

二、数据库有哪些类型?如何选择适合自己的?🤔

数据库主要分为关系型数据库和非关系型数据库两大类:
1. **关系型数据库**(RDBMS):以表格形式存储数据,使用SQL语言进行操作。常见的有MySQL、Oracle、PostgreSQL等。这种类型的数据库适合需要复杂查询和事务处理的场景,比如银行系统。
2. **非关系型数据库**(NoSQL):不依赖固定的表格结构,更适合处理大规模分布式数据。例如MongoDB、Redis等。这类数据库常用于实时数据分析和互联网应用。
那该怎么选择呢?简单来说,如果你的数据具有明确的结构并且需要频繁的事务处理,那就选关系型数据库;如果数据规模大且结构灵活,则可以选择非关系型数据库。
💡 小贴士:刚开始学习时,建议从MySQL入手,因为它简单易学且功能强大,非常适合新手练习。

三、学习数据库需要掌握哪些基础知识?📚

学习数据库之前,先要了解几个关键概念:
1. **表(Table)**:数据库中的基本单位,由行和列组成,类似于Excel表格。
2. **字段(Field)**:表中的每一列,表示数据的一个属性,比如姓名、年龄等。
3. **记录(Record)**:表中的每一行,表示一组相关数据,比如某个人的所有信息。
4. **主键(Primary Key)**:用来唯一标识表中的一条记录,确保每条数据不重复。
5. **外键(Foreign Key)**:用于建立不同表之间的关联关系,实现数据的完整性。
此外,还需要熟悉SQL语言的基本语法,包括SELECT、INSERT、UPDATE、DELETE等常用命令。通过这些命令,你可以对数据库进行增删改查操作。
💡 小贴士:不要害怕术语太多,其实它们都很直观。比如“主键”就是用来标记唯一的,“外键”就是用来连接外部的。多动手实践几次,就会发现它们并不难理解。

四、如何高效学习数据库应用教程?💻

以下是几个实用的学习技巧:
1. **理论结合实践**:看书或视频学习的同时,一定要动手搭建自己的数据库环境。推荐使用XAMPP或WAMP工具包,它们内置了MySQL服务器,方便初学者安装和配置。
2. **从小项目开始**:尝试构建一些简单的应用场景,比如学生管理系统、图书借阅系统等。通过实际开发,你会更深刻地理解数据库的设计原则。
3. **多写SQL语句**:熟能生巧,只有不断练习才能提高查询能力。可以从网上找一些经典的SQL题目,逐步提升难度。
4. **参与开源项目**:加入GitHub上的数据库相关项目,不仅能学到更多知识,还能结识志同道合的朋友。
💡 小贴士:学习过程中遇到问题别气馁,试着搜索Stack Overflow或者国内的技术论坛,很多前辈都愿意分享经验哦!

五、未来发展方向有哪些?🚀

掌握了数据库原理后,你可以朝着以下几个方向发展:
1. **数据库管理员(DBA)**:负责数据库的维护、备份和性能优化等工作。
2. **数据分析师**:利用SQL和其他工具提取有价值的信息,为企业决策提供支持。
3. **软件工程师**:将数据库技术融入到应用程序开发中,设计高效的后端架构。
无论选择哪条路,都需要持续学习新技术,比如云计算数据库(AWS DynamoDB)、大数据处理框架(Hadoop、Spark)等。
💡 小贴士:随着人工智能的发展,数据库与AI的结合越来越紧密。学会用数据库存储和管理机器学习模型数据,将成为一大趋势。

总结一下吧! 数据库原理及应用教程虽然听起来有点复杂,但只要按照正确的学习路径一步步走,小白也可以轻松入门💪。从理解基本概念到熟练掌握SQL语言,再到实际项目开发,每个阶段都有对应的资源和方法可供参考。
最重要的是保持好奇心和耐心,多动手实践,多思考实际应用场景。相信我,当你成功搭建起第一个属于自己的数据库时,那种成就感绝对会让你爱上这门技术!🌟快收藏这篇文章,开启你的数据库学习之旅吧!


TAG:教育 | 数据库 | 数据库原理 | 应用教程 | 学习方法 | 快速入门
文章链接:https://www.9educ.com/shujuku/242923.html
提示:本信息均源自互联网,只能做为信息参考,并不能作为任何依据,准确性和时效性需要读者进一步核实,请不要下载与分享,本站也不为此信息做任何负责,内容或者图片如有误请及时联系本站,我们将在第一时间做出修改或者删除
国产数据库管理系统有哪些值得推荐?✨哪些
介绍几款优秀的国产数据库管理系统,分析其特点及应用场景,并探讨哪些系统更适合教育行业的实际需求。
SQL数据库有哪些?新手如何选择适合的数
详细介绍SQL数据库的种类及其特点,帮助新手理解不同数据库的功能和适用场景,并提供实用建议,让你
数据库客户端配置到底怎么弄?🤔小白也能快
详细解答数据库客户端配置的核心步骤,涵盖驱动安装、连接参数设置及常见问题排查,帮助初学者轻松搞定
数据库名词解释有哪些?📚初学者必看!✨
整理数据库学习中常见的核心名词解释,帮助初学者快速掌握数据库基础概念,通过趣味化和专业化的解读,
数据库是什么?为什么学习数据库很重要?💡
数据库是现代信息技术的核心之一,本文通过通俗易懂的比喻和实际应用场景,解答“数据库是什么”这一问
教育本站内容和图片均来自互联网,仅供读者参考,请勿转载与分享,如有内容和图片有误或者涉及侵权请及时联系本站处理。
Encyclopediaknowledge
菜谱食谱美食穿搭文化sneaker球鞋街头奢侈品时尚百科养生健康彩妆美妆化妆品美容问答国外海外攻略古迹名胜景区景点旅行旅游学校大学英语移民留学学习教育篮球足球主播导演明星动漫综艺电视剧电影影视科技潮牌品牌生活家电健身旅游数码美丽体育汽车游戏娱乐潮流网红热榜知识